 Weekend in Algeria
In terms of the Moslem custom, the weekend in Algeria usually starts from the afternoon of Wednesday. Practically, the weekend for government agencies is Thursday and Friday as well as for banks and post offices is Friday and Saturday. On Friday, all of the commercial departments are closed except for the retail stores.

 Major Cities
Oran: This port city has 1,155,000 population and relatively developed economy and culture. The city also mixes the traditional Arab scenes and the feature of the modern cities. 

Constantine: The 2500 years old city preserves a number of historical sites. The delicate carpets made here are also well-known.

Djemila: One of the most splendid Roman historical sites is located here. Monasteries, palaces and charming murals make up a mysterious city. 

Tlemcen: Nearby Morocco, Tlemcen is surrounded by grape gardens, orchards and evergreen trees. The local carpets and silver souvenirs are favored by travelers all the time.

Batna: Timgad is the larges and best preserved ancient Roman historical sites in North Africa that has been listed in the World Heritage List in 1982.
